自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

转载 内存分配——栈、堆、静态区、符号区等等

一个由C/C++编译的程序占用的内存分为以下几个部分  1、栈区(stack)— 由编译器自动分配释放 ,存放函数参数值,局部变量的值等。其操作方式类似于数据结构中的栈。  2、堆区(heap) — 一般由程序员分配释放 , 若程序员不释放,程序结束时可能由OS回收 。注意它与数据结构中的堆是...

2015-07-31 15:14:31

阅读数 389

评论数 0

原创 嵌入式Linux驱动开发案例流程--LED驱动

本文主要是以一个最简单的LED驱动开发流程,来窥探一下Linux驱动开发为何物。 基本流程: 1.编写驱动文件xxxx.c 这个文件的主要作用是对设备硬件初始化,主要是xxx_init(),其中也包括设备的注册。         对file_operations结构体进行初始化,这个初始化...

2015-07-14 14:39:30

阅读数 1188

评论数 0

原创 Vmware Workstation中配置Fedora的bridge上网

在虚拟机中安装了Fedora9后,遇到了不能上网的问题,需要进行配置,现将配置过程总结如下: 1.在vmware workstation中设定fedora上网方式为“bridge”。 2.查看win7电脑中的IP地址、子网掩码、网关、DNS,并记录。 3.进入Fedora9桌面中,选择“Sy...

2015-07-06 10:06:19

阅读数 784

评论数 0

转载 基于uboot及TFTP通信向开发板烧写程序的详细分析

最近接触了Tiny6410及TQ2440开发板,这里吐槽一下,这两种开发板算是小有名气了,尤其是TQ,太过垃圾了,裸机程序都没有,开发板,最值钱的恰恰就是教程,教程越详细越好。Tiny6410开发板略微好一些,但是仍然不够详细,Tiny6410的烧写程序工具是Minitool软件,不过这个软件不太...

2015-07-01 18:29:58

阅读数 1538

评论数 0

提示
确定要删除当前文章?
取消 删除